行数取决于用户输入。 我想让用户创建,填充或编辑单元格。 可能吗?任何帮助,将不胜感激。谢谢。 for($ r = 1; $ r< = $ row; $ r ++){ for($ c = 1; $ c< = $ col; $ c ++){ $ w = 180/2; $ h = 200 / $ row;
$pdf->SetTextColor(0,0,0);
$pdf->Cell($w, $h, '', 1,0, 'C');
答案 0 :(得分:2)
我将以可编辑的方式假设,您的意思是用户可以将文本输入某个区域。
在这种情况下,您应该查看TextField
方法。
TextField
有关完整示例,请参阅示例文件夹或tcpdf.org examples page中的示例014
。该示例还包括设置填充和描边颜色等表单属性。
如示例代码中所述,如果您在输出PDF中包含表单字段,则需要禁用字体子设置。
基本上,只需让你的循环创建你想要的文本字段数。
编辑:循环应为每个TextField
提供唯一的字段名称。